No, and we'll look back on this year as the year it ended for this core.

I don't know why everyone is expecting Klay to look like himself again - at his age and with his injury history, the decline he's showing is exactly what should be expected.

Draymond also turns 34 this year. We should expect to see him slow down/deal with more injuries.

It's also important to keep in mind that ageing isn't some slow, linear regression. As they get older, players become more injury prone. It doesn't go "the guy slowed down by 5% each year, started otherwise healthy, then retired."

So even Curry should be expected to be injured at some point.
